QUALIFICATIONS:
* Valid Michigan Special Education Teacher Certification
* Appropriate Special Education Endorsement (SV) Autism Spectrum Disorder
* Experience with Special Education population preferred
* Must meet MCL 380.1531 & Administrative Rules Governing the Certification of MI Teachers
* START Training preferred
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the Board of Education and/or Superintendent may find appropriate and acceptable
DUTIES:
* Adapt, accommodate, and modify the general education curricula, pedagogy, and learning environments for students with Autism Spectrum Disorder
* Assess, teach, and modify instruction and curricula for students with Autism Spectrum Disorder
* Implement trauma-informed/resiliency based strategies & interventions
* Align and adapt the student's program with the general education curriculum
* Develop, implement, and evaluate individualized behavior management strategies and plans. Must prepare and implement behavior plans based upon functional behavioral assessments.
* Use a range of curriculum guides to assist with identifying functional goals.
* Employ current assessment instruments and approaches, intervention methodologies, strategies, and techniques that are appropriate for students with diagnosed with Autism Spectrum Disorder linking assessment outcomes to curriculum planning.
* Complete records in a timely manner
* Communicate to all members of the school & community
* Meet the physical and mental demands of the teaching profession and the position
* Philosophy in accordance with Lincoln Park Public Schools
* Work collaboratively
* Follow requirements of special education supervisors
* Provide classroom instruction and be an instructional leader for meeting the needs of students with Autism Spectrum Disorder
* Support Peer to Peer program
* Work collaboratively with general education teachers to provide LRE for students with Autism
Other duties as assigned
